Call of Duty: Infinite Warfare will have 10 Prestiges total

Keshav Bhat

In an interview PlayStation Lifestyle, Infinity Ward’s multiplayer Project Director Jordan Hirsh has stated that they are planning to have 10 total prestiges in Call of Duty: Infinite Warfare.

After each prestige, you will get an unlock token similar to previous Call of Duty titles. He also said in his response that the number of prestiges could increase based upon feedback in the future, but they do not have anything to announce as of now.

The Prestige system as it stands is pretty similar to what players have seen in the past and experienced. So as you Prestige you’ll unlock a Prestige token, and be able to bring over with you one item that would normally be gated via your player rank. Maximum Prestige right now that we’re planning is 10. That’s subject to change based on how things go in the future. We can adjust our experience curve, and we want that experience to be good for pretty much everybody.
